The continuous casting grey cast iron market is defined by the automated process of solidifying molten iron into semi-finished or finished products through continuous casting technology. This method enhances production efficiency, improves material quality, and reduces waste, making it vital for high-volume manufacturing industries. Q5. What are the main applications of Grey Cast Iron produced via continuous casting?
Applications include automotive engine blocks, pipes, machinery components, and construction materials, owing to its durability and cost-effectiveness. The versatility supports diverse industrial needs.

Q10. How do raw material prices influence the Grey Cast Iron market?
Raw material costs, especially iron ore and coke, significantly impact production expenses and profit margins. Price volatility can affect supply stability and market pricing strategies.
